How are you gon na build that audience, and the first thing that you should do is think about what you're actually good at, if you're good at writing short form content? Maybe twitter is good for you if you're good at audio, maybe podcasting is good for you. If you're good at video, you start with video first, if you're good at illustrations, you go to illustrations. If you're good at designing stuff, you go with designing right. There'S a guy named visualize value on instagram. He does really good work and all his stuff is really simple designs: um naval ravicon, he built his brand off of twitter jason lemkin built his brand off of cora right he's got this the the largest um sas conference in the in the world. Right now, the largest uh sas community.
